Types of Orthodontic Expansion Screws in the US Market
Orthodontic expansion screws play a crucial role in orthodontic treatments by facilitating controlled expansion of the dental arch. In the Global market, these devices are primarily categorized into two main types: tooth-borne and bone-borne expansion screws. Tooth-borne expansion screws, such as the Haas and Hyrax designs, are anchored to the teeth using bands or bonding techniques. They exert force on the teeth directly, allowing for controlled movement and expansion of the dental arch over time.
Bone-borne expansion screws, on the other hand, attach to the bone of the maxilla or the mandible. Known examples include devices like the MARPE (Miniscrew Assisted Rapid Palatal Expander), which utilize miniscrews inserted into the bone for stability. These screws provide more localized force application, reducing the stress on teeth and optimizing skeletal expansion. Bone-borne screws are particularly beneficial in cases where tooth-borne options may not achieve desired results due to dental limitations.
Another significant category within the US market includes hybrid expansion screws, which combine aspects of both tooth-borne and bone-borne designs. These hybrids aim to leverage the advantages of each type while mitigating their respective limitations. For instance, hybrid designs may incorporate miniscrews for bone anchorage while utilizing bands or brackets for tooth connection, providing a versatile solution for orthodontists managing complex cases.

19. What are the key materials used in the manufacturing of orthodontic expansion screws?
The key materials used in the manufacturing of orthodontic expansion screws include stainless steel, titanium, and nickel-titanium alloys.
